1. You say on the site: "Start your 14 day free trial" but there's no clear pricing, so what happens after 14 days?
2. People are visual, I'd put a whole flow in a gif, something, with the picture (screenshot) of the email that's being sent to the client.
3. If you have plans for integration with popular systems, like Trello, Github, Basecamp or others, I'd put logos of those with "Integration coming soon"
4. Inside the systems, the Preview of the emails are too long, when you have a project you usually need 10-20 reminders, I'd cut the length of the preview to 200-300 chars and have a separate page for each of those. (also add an edit option, so if I have a typo, I can fix it easily).
